基于回归分析与神经网络的短期负荷预测
Short-Term Load Forecasting Algorithm Based on Regression Analysis and the Combination of Genetic Algorithm and Neural Network
【摘要】 针对电力系统短期负荷预测中神经网络输入变量选择与网络训练问题,提出了一种基于回归分析与神经网络相结合的短期负荷预测方法,利用回归分析选择神经网络的输入变量,利用遗传算法训练神经网络。实例研究结果表明该方法可以取得较高的预测精度。
【Abstract】 In allusion to the input variables choice and training of artificial neural network in short-term load forecasting of electrical power system,a short-term load forecasting algorithm based on regression analysis and neural network is presented.Input variables of neural network is selected by regression analysis and training neural network is trained by genetic algorithm.The result of study indicates that this method can gain a higher forecasting precision.
